Generate pod.yaml from current context
We want to generate pod.yaml from Heat contexts so we can
re-use the context without destroying it.
But we don't have node role information and it doesn't
make sense in this case, so make the role optional.
Since we changed Heat to use pkey instead of key_filename,
we can embed the pkey into the pod.yaml, but we have
to make sure to convert the pkey to string, in case
it is a RSAKey object
